This is a fantastic new opportunity for a Sous Chef to join an award-winning pub and restaurant, which is part of a highly successful group.

As Sous Chef, you'll be instrumental in the overall running of a busy kitchen. You'll work with the best quality seasonal British produce from bespoke suppliers, with the opportunity to contribute your ideas towards changing menus.

Salary: £55,000-£60,000

Hours: Circa 48 hours per week

Location: West London

Expanding group

The Person:

  • Previous experience within quality 1-2 AA Rosette + restaurants as either a Sous Chef or a Junior Sous Chef ready for progression.
  • Sound knowledge of seasonal British/European Cuisine.
  • An interest in butchery/cooking over fire would be desirable, yet not essential.
  • An inspiring leader who will mentor, develop and help to retain a close-knit team of Chefs.
  • Sound financial awareness with experience of ordering and rota writing.
  • Proficient training in Food Safety, Health & Safety and HACCP.

How to prepare for a job interview at Collins King & Associates Limited

Know Your Ingredients

Familiarise yourself with seasonal British produce and the suppliers the restaurant uses. Being able to discuss your favourite ingredients and how you would incorporate them into the menu will show your passion and knowledge.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Sous Chef, you'll need to inspire and mentor your team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a kitchen team in the past, focusing on your approach to training and retaining staff.

Demonstrate Financial Savvy

Brush up on your financial awareness, especially regarding ordering and rota writing. Be ready to discuss how you've managed kitchen budgets or improved cost efficiency in previous roles.

Safety First

Make sure you're well-versed in Food Safety, Health & Safety, and HACCP regulations. Be prepared to talk about how you ensure compliance in the kitchen and any relevant training you've received.
